That 1 picture of that rock has a name for it. If you look at it right it looks like a woman laying down. They have a name for it but I just can't seem to remember what the name is. Its something to do with an Idian woman laying down.

That rock is just about 3 miles from my place in Christams Valley that I have had for about 10 years now. I LOVE it over there. You can have deer and VERY BIG jack rabbits in your yard in the morning or even in the evening to watch.

I spent last Christams vacation there at my place and it NEVER got any higher than -22 degree's the whole time I was there. If you ever get a chance be sure to go to the crack in the ground and the hole in the ground.

You have to drive further to get to them now because some damn kids started the rest rooms on fire so they make you walk to the site now unles they have changed it in the last few months.

One year we had about 45 inches of snow at my place. Thank god I had a 4 wheel drive pickup. There are roads all over the place to drive on. You can go for miles and miles on those old roads.

I spent ALL DAY one day just driving on those old roads. I took more than 200 pictures in just 2 days there. They even have a golf course in Christmas Valley. There at the lodge there is a small lake where they set off fire works on the 4th of July.

I ALWAYS have alot of fun when I go there on the weekend's. It's a place everyone should go to and check it out.
